A Trio of High Earnings Yield Stocks to Consider

Their earnings yields have outperformed the 20-year high quality corporate bonds

Article's Main Image

If you select stocks that more than double the earnings yield that 20-year high-quality corporate bonds are granting to their holders, you could increase your chances to unearth value opportunities, in my opinion. These bonds, which entail a very low risk of bankruptcy as they represent corporate loans issued by investment-grade companies, are currently yielding a 2.84% monthly return to their holders.

Thus, investors may be interested in the following stocks, as they offer earnings yields of more than 5.7% and have price-earnings ratios below 17.6.

American Equity Investment Life Holding Co

Shares of American Equity Investment Life Holding Co AEL were trading at $31.68 per unit at close on Thursday for a market capitalization of $2.91 billion.

The West Des Moines, Iowa-based provider of life insurance products and services to individuals in the United States offers an earnings yield of 8.3% and has a price-earnings (PE) ratio without non-recurring items (NRI) of 12.09.

The share price has risen nearly 43% over the past year, determining a 52-week range of $9.07 to $34.25.

GuruFocus assigned a positive rating of 5 out of 10 for both the company's financial strength and its profitability.

Wall Street sell-side analysts recommend a hold rating with an average target price of $28.29 per share for this stock.

PulteGroup Inc

Shares of PulteGroup Inc PHM was trading at a price of $47.46 each at close on Thursday for a market capitalization of $12.73 billion.

The Atlanta, Georgia-based home builder offers an earnings yield of 8.9% and has a PE without NRI ratio of 11.19.

The stock has risen by 31.2% over the past year, determining a 52-week range of $17.12 to $48.

GuruFocus assigned a very good rating of 7 out of 10 to the company's financial strength and a high rating of 8 out of 10 to its profitability.

Wall Street sell-side analysts recommend an overweight rating for this stock and have established an average target price of $49.15 per share.

LPL Financial Holdings Inc

Shares of LPL Financial Holdings Inc LPLA were trading at $76.65 per unit at close on Thursday for a market capitalization of $6.06 billion.

The San Diego, California-based provider of brokerage and investment advisory services to U.S. financial institutions offers an earnings yield of 8.2% and has a PE without NRI ratio of 12.19.

The stock has risen by 6.3% over the past year for a 52-week range of $32.01 to $99.60.

GuruFocus assigned a low rating of 3 out of 10 to the company's financial strength and a moderate rating of 4 out of 10 to its profitability.

Wall Street sell-side analysts recommend an overweight rating with an average target price of $95.50 per share for this stock.
